The legacy of J.press
Founded in 1902 by Jacobi Press in New Haven, Connecticut, J.Press has long been associated with the Ivy League wardrobe, particularly Yale University.
The brand’s commitment to quality and authenticity has remained unwavering for generations.
J.Press men's clothing doesn’t follow fleeting trends, instead it evolves with intention, retaining its identity while embracing the nuances of modern menswear. Each jacket, shirt, or pair of trousers carries with it a legacy of American tailoring and a spirit of understated excellence.

How to Style
The beauty of J.Press men's clothing lies in its versatility. Pair a soft-shouldered blazer with a crisp Oxford shirt and tailored wool trousers for a look that reads confident and classic.
For a relaxed yet polished outfit, style a sport coat over a lightweight knit and chinos.
J.Press outerwear and layering pieces also shine during transitional seasons easily styled over collared shirts or sweaters. Add a pocket square or tie for a subtle dash of personality, and finish with loafers or brogues to complete the ensemble.
